Russia confirms use of thermobaric 'vacuum bombs' in Ukraine, UK says
Russia has tested its use of a thermobaric weapon equipment, or "vacuum" bombs, all the way through Putin's invasion of Ukraine, the uk Ministry of protection pointed out Wednesday.
Vacuum bombs disperse explosive fabric over a big area that uses surrounding oxygen as fuel when it detonates, making a blast wave that lasts a long way longer than typical explosives. Thermobaric bombs are able to sucking the air out of grownup's lungs, inflicting them to fill with liquid, or inflicting an individual's lungs to rupture or explode.
"The impact of the [TOS-1A] is devastating," the united kingdom Ministry of defense noted in a video. "it may ruin infrastructure and trigger big damage to inside organs and flash burns, leading to loss of life to these uncovered."

Pentagon opposes transfer of MiG 29 planes from Poland to Ukraine, calls move 'excessive-risk'
Pentagon Press Secretary John Kirby noted Wednesday that defense Secretary Lloyd Austin spoke together with his Polish counterpart, Mariusz Blaszczak, and advised him that the USA will no longer support Poland's suggestion to carry MiG-29s to the Ukrainian armed forces.
"The secretary also had a chance to confer with Minister Blaszczak the notion to ship MiG-29 fighter aircraft to Ukraine and, peculiarly, the thought of doing so by using a means of switch to U.S. custody," Kirby talked about. "Secretary Austin thanked the minister for Poland's willingness to proceed to seem for methods to support Ukraine, however he wired that we do not aid the switch of extra fighter aircraft to the Ukrainian air drive at the present and hence don't have any desire to look them in our custody both."
"We agree with the supply of additional fighter aircraft provides little increased capabilities at high risk," Kirby persisted.
"We assess that adding plane to the Ukrainian stock isn't prone to enormously change the effectiveness of Ukrainian Air drive relative to Russian capabilities," Kirby talked about. "hence, we accept as true with that the gain from transferring those MIG 29s is low."
Kirbv also noted during the briefing that the united states should "be careful about each determination we make" to make certain "that we aren't making the expertise for escalation worse."

Ukraine's Chernobyl nuclear vigour plant loses vigour, sparking concern of radiation leaks
The Chernobyl plant in Ukraine is disconnected from the grid as a result of hurt inflicted by means of Russian occupying forces, sparking issues of radioactive infection if the cooling of spent nuclear fuel stops.
The 750 kV Chernobyl-Kyiv high-voltage line is at the moment disconnected "because of hurt by using the occupiers," Energoatom, or the state-run countrywide Nuclear energy producing business of Ukraine, noted Wednesday. The Chernobyl station and all nuclear facilities of the Exclusion Zone are devoid of electricity.
The regulator defined that there are about 20,000 spent gasoline assemblies kept at the facility that require steady cooling. without electricity to cool the pumps, the temperature in the preserving pools will enhance, prompting the unencumber of radioactive supplies into the atmosphere.

WHO: 18 documented attacks on Ukraine fitness care facilities
the area health corporation spoke of Wednesday it has documented 18 assaults on health amenities, workers and ambulances considering that the Russian invasion of Ukraine started in late February.
At a press briefing on Wednesday, WHO director-general Tedros Adhanom Ghebreyesus said the U.N. fitness agency has delivered eighty one metric hundreds materials to Ukraine and is now organising a pipeline to send further equipment.
to this point, Tedros observed WHO had despatched ample surgical components to treat one hundred fifty trauma patients and other materials for various health situations to treat 45,000 people.
Dr. Michael Ryan, WHO's emergencies chief, mentioned that sending scientific resources to Ukraine was not going to make a huge change.
"this is placing bandages on mortal wounds at the moment," he talked about.
WHO chief Tedros spoke of some of the leading health challenges officials have been facing in Ukraine were hypothermia and frostbite, respiratory disorder, heart sickness, cancer and intellectual fitness concerns. He introduced that WHO staffers have been sent to countries neighbouring Ukraine to provide mental fitness assist to fleeing refugees, in most cases ladies and youngsters.

China sending nearly $1 million in Ukraine assist regardless of nonetheless opposing Russia sanctions
China introduced Wednesday that it is sending round $800,000 in humanitarian help to Ukraine -- together with food and each day needs -- regardless of carrying on with to oppose sanctions in opposition t Russia.
overseas Ministry spokesperson Zhao Lijian advised newshounds an initial batch became despatched to the Ukrainian red go on Wednesday with greater to observe "as soon as possible."
China has generally backed Russia within the battle and Zhao reiterated Beijing's opposition to financial sanctions in opposition t Moscow.
Zhao advised reporters at an everyday briefing that "wielding the stick of sanctions at every turn will certainly not deliver peace and security but trigger serious difficulties to the economies and livelihoods of the countries worried."
He pointed out China and Russia will "proceed to perform normal trade cooperation, together with oil and gas alternate, in the spirit of mutual respect, equality and mutual advantage."

New Zealand imposes sanctions that might hold nation from being Russian oligarch refuge
A sanctions bill unanimously handed in New Zealand's parliament on Wednesday to punish Russians worried in the Ukraine invasion.
the new legislation became pushed through in one day and will allow the nation to freeze property and prevent superyachts or planes from arriving. Lawmakers said it would stop New Zealand fitting a safe haven for Russian oligarchs looking to evade sanctions elsewhere.
prior to now, New Zealand legislation made in inconceivable to put enormous sanctions on Russia until it was a part of a bigger United countries effort.

twin Russian-U.S. citizen charged with appearing as Kremlin undercover agent: DOJ
She was born in the Soviet Union and emigrated to the U.S. at 30. nine years later, in 1999, she grew to be an American citizen.
Then greater than a decade later, the department of Justice alleges, she grew to become a spy on behalf of Vladimir Putin and Russia.
Elena Branson, 61, is accused of flouting the international Agent Registration Act, or FARA, and failing to appropriately inform the U.S. executive she turned into engaged on behalf of the Kremlin.
"Elena Branson… actively subverted international agent registration legal guidelines within the u.s. in order to promote Russian guidelines and beliefs," according to Damian Williams, the U.S. attorney for the Southern District of ny. "Branson is speculated to have corresponded with Putin himself and met with a high-ranking Russia minister before founding a Russian propaganda core right here in ny city, the Russian middle big apple."
